#0c638d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c638d is composed of 4.7% red, 38.8%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.5% cyan, 29.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 199.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 30%. #0c638d color hex could be obtained by blending #18c6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#0c638d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c638d has RGB values of R:12, G:99,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 811917.

Shades and Tints of #0c638d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0e is the darkest color, while #fbfeff is the lightest one.
